Re: [gentoo-user] Patch file for cdrtools to allow --duplicates-once

2008-09-30 Thread Sascha Hlusiak
However, I don't know how to use the output of find cd-root -type f -or -type l | xargs sha1sum -b to find duplicate files. Maybe someone can donate a perl/python script to find duplicate files and list them? find . -type f -print0 | xargs -0 -L 1 md5sum | sort | uniq -w 20 -D - Sascha
